The LZ-8/POL is a simple passive power supply distributor designed to deliver power from a single high-capacity power source to multiple devices. It splits the input into 8 outputs, each protected by a polymer fuse and featuring an output voltage indicator (the corresponding LED lights up when voltage is present at the output). If an output is overloaded, the resistance and temperature of the polymer fuse increase (>100°C), causing the LED indicator to turn off. Only a minimal current flows through the heated fuse, and after the overload ends, the fuse automatically resets to its previous state.
The device is equipped with jumpers for easy deactivation of individual outputs. The LZ-8/POL features two parallel power inputs, allowing connection via either a DC 5.5/2.1 socket or a terminal block. This design enables multiple LZ-8/POL distributors to be linked in series—for example, the main supply can be connected to the DC IN socket of the first unit, and its input terminal block can be connected via a two-core cable (e.g., WT-2.1) to the input of a second LZ-8/POL. Depending on current consumption, the voltage drop across the polymer fuses is 160mV at I=0.5A and 300mV at I=0.7A. During overload, the fuse heats up to over 100°C, so the device should not be used in environments exceeding 40°C.
It is ideal for use with 5.5/2.1mm plugs and YAP75 cables, commonly used in camera installations. A standard CCTV YAP75-0.59/3.7+2x0.5 cable has two 0.5mm² wires. The theoretical resistance is 3.4Ω/100m, while manufacturer data states 5.5Ω/100m. When powering cameras with 12V DC over CCTV YAP75 cable, assuming a voltage drop to 11V, power can be delivered over the distances shown in the table below. These are the maximum distances for powering 12V cameras over YAP-75-0.59/3.7+2x0.5 cable.
Max. current | Max. distance at R=3.4Ω/100m | Max. distance at R=5.5Ω/100m |
150mA camera | 98 meters | 60 meters |
650mA camera + thermostat | 22 meters | 14 meters |
An unquestionable advantage of using the LZ-8/POL in centrally powered monitoring systems is the added protection against intentional sabotage. Without individual protection for each power line, an intruder could disable the entire system by short-circuiting the supply to a single camera.
SPECIFICATIONS
Number of power outputs: | 8 |
Number of power inputs: | 2 |
Max. voltage: | DC 0 - 24 V (usually 12 V) |
Max. total current: | 2.1/5.5mm socket: 4A |
Max. single output current: | 0.7 A |
Type of fuses: | polymer |
Power inputs socket type: | 2.1/5.5 mm socket / terminals |
Power outputs socket type: | terminals |
Working temp. / relative humidity: | from -40°C to +45°C / < 95% |
Dimensions (W x H x D) / weight: | 116 x 46 x 25 mm / 90 g |
